Accessibility through Windy Arbour Luas
Windy Arbour Luas station, established in 2004, serves the Green Line of Dublin's light rail system, enhancing urban mobility.
It features modern architecture with a spacious platform designed for safety and comfort. The station serves as a link between residential areas and the city center, making it significant for daily commuters and tourists alike.

Efficiency in Transit
Windy Arbour Luas is part of the Dublin Light Rail network, designed to reduce road congestion.
Green Line Contribution
It connects critical suburban areas to the city center, supporting local commerce.
